Output b1581ea688607305a430b01d3d1a9ff9086c7c4ce1c2fa479086bb2aa5f1c26f:6

value
17738623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4b39c54a61d2f020d86069ac2b79561c27169e OP_EQUAL
address
3Fkr6rdpbk8A7wHNL8EvoyHDJLhJFxyLD6
transaction
b1581ea688607305a430b01d3d1a9ff9086c7c4ce1c2fa479086bb2aa5f1c26f
spent
true